Dubai: An inspection campaign on leisurely motorbike users in desert locations has been launched by the Control and Inspections department at the Roads and Transport Authority.
UAE | Government
Dubai authority probes motorbike users
Roads and Transport Authority inspects motorbikes in desert areas
The one-week campaign will secure motorbike users abiding by rules and regulations of driving on the road and to license leisure motorbikes in Dubai.
Abdullah Al Muharah, director of the department, said that inspection campaigns are being conducted in desert areas which has been witnessing a lot of activity by motorbike users. The aim of the campaign is to secure the safety of the users and make sure they abide by the law.
